Common Welder’s Certifications
Despite the fact that the American Welding Society’s standard Certified Welder certificate paves the way for almost all employment opportunities, many fields call for their own specific certification. A handful of the most-popular of which appear below.
- SCWI and CWI Certifications for Welding Inspectors and Senior Welding Inspectors
- API Certification for welders who work on pipelines in the gas and oil industry
- Certified Welder Certificates to be a Certified Welder
- ASME Certification for individuals who work on boiler and pressurized vessels

The subsequent graphic features jobs and wage forecasts for professional welders in California through the end of the decade.
| California | Employment |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2012 | 2022 | Change | Annual Job Openings |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ers | 24,700 | 26,300 | 7% | 770 |
| California | Annual Salary | ||
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| Median | High |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ers |
$23,900 | $38,600 | $65,600 |
Source: O*Net Online
